What is Plinko?

At its core, Plinko is an "immediate win" or "crash-style" game. The premise is deceivingly simple: a ball (or disk) is dropped from the top of a pyramid-shaped board filled with barriers (typically pegs). As the ball bounces off these pegs, its trajectory is randomized till it lands in among the slots at the bottom. Each slot is appointed a particular multiplier, figuring out the player's payment.

Unlike conventional table video games like Blackjack or Poker, which require comprehensive skill and knowledge of possibility, Plinko is a game of pure chance. It sits at the intersection of game gaming and casino gambling, providing a visual experience that is both rewarding and nerve-wracking.

How the Game Functions

The mechanics of Plinko count on a Random Number Generator (RNG) or Provably Fair innovation, making sure that each drop is independent and unbiased. When a player initiates a drop, the game software determines the course based on the selected danger level and the variety of rows on the board.

Setting Your Parameters

Before launching the ball, gamers generally configure the following variables:

  1. Risk Level: Usually categorized as Low, Medium, or High.
  2. Number of Rows: Most versions enable you to change the board size (e.g., 8 to 16 rows). More rows generally increase the optimal prospective multiplier.
  3. Bet Amount: The stake per ball dropped.

The Relationship Between Risk and Reward

The core of Plinko method depends on how these specifications engage. A board with more rows and a "High" plinko gambling game threat setting will offer enormous multipliers (sometimes going beyond 1,000 x the bet) but will also include numerous slots that return 0x or less than the preliminary stake.

Table 1: Typical Risk vs. Reward Profiles

Risk Level Volatility Common Min Multiplier Normal Max Multiplier Low Minimal 0.5 x 5x-- 10x Medium Moderate 0.2 x 50x-- 100x High Extreme 0x 500x-- 1000x+

Important Considerations Before Playing

Before diving into Plinko, it is essential to keep the following truths in mind:

  • The House Edge: Always inspect the Return to Player (RTP) portion of the specific variation of Plinko you are playing. Most online gambling establishments offer an RTP in between 97% and 99%.
  • Accountable Gambling: Because Plinko relocations so quickly, it is simple to lose track of how much cash has actually been wagered in a short period. Set stringent deposit and time frame.
  • Avoid "Systems": No software application or pattern-following system can predict where the ball will land. Deal with the game as entertainment, not a source of earnings.
